Skip site navigation (1)Skip section navigation (2)
Date:      Fri, 2 Dec 2022 01:33:01 GMT
From:      Jan Beich <jbeich@FreeBSD.org>
To:        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-main@FreeBSD.org
Subject:   git: a2b734c4eee4 - main - graphics/libheif: rename SVT to SVTAV1 for consistency
Message-ID:  <202212020133.2B21X1rC029956@gitrepo.freebsd.org>

next in thread | raw e-mail | index | archive | help
The branch main has been updated by jbeich:

URL: https://cgit.FreeBSD.org/ports/commit/?id=a2b734c4eee464a28d22e2983081f86701a33d84

commit a2b734c4eee464a28d22e2983081f86701a33d84
Author:     Jan Beich <jbeich@FreeBSD.org>
AuthorDate: 2022-12-01 16:57:19 +0000
Commit:     Jan Beich <jbeich@FreeBSD.org>
CommitDate: 2022-12-02 01:31:48 +0000

    graphics/libheif: rename SVT to SVTAV1 for consistency
    
    - ffmpeg and libavif already use SVTAV1 option
    - libheif doesn't support SVT-HEVC for *.heif
    - SVTAV1 can be globally disabled via OPTIONS_UNSET
    
    PR:             268102
    Approved by:    makc (maintainer)
---
 graphics/libheif/Makefile  | 10 +++++-----
 graphics/libheif/pkg-plist |  2 +-
 2 files changed, 6 insertions(+), 6 deletions(-)

diff --git a/graphics/libheif/Makefile b/graphics/libheif/Makefile
index 50a854fd2388..08420ff65b9b 100644
--- a/graphics/libheif/Makefile
+++ b/graphics/libheif/Makefile
@@ -18,14 +18,14 @@ USE_GNOME=	gdkpixbuf2 glib20
 USE_LDCONFIG=	yes
 PLIST_SUB=	LIB_VER=${DISTVERSION}.0
 
-OPTIONS_DEFINE=		AOM DAV1D EXAMPLES LIBDE265 SVT RAV1E X265
+OPTIONS_DEFINE=		AOM DAV1D EXAMPLES LIBDE265 SVTAV1 RAV1E X265
 OPTIONS_DEFAULT=	AOM DAV1D LIBDE265 X265
 OPTIONS_SUB=	yes
 
 AOM_DESC=		AV1 encoding/decoding via libaom
 DAV1D_DESC=		Build dav1e decoder
 LIBDE265_DESC=		Use libde265 (support for HEVC decoding)
-SVT_DESC=		Build svt-av1 encoder
+SVTAV1_DESC=		Build svt-av1 encoder
 RAV1E_DESC=		Build rav1e encoder
 X265_DESC=		Use x265 (support for HEVC encoding)
 
@@ -42,9 +42,9 @@ EXAMPLES_CMAKE_BOOL=	WITH_EXAMPLES
 LIBDE265_LIB_DEPENDS=	libde265.so:multimedia/libde265
 LIBDE265_CMAKE_BOOL=	WITH_LIBDE265
 
-SVT_LIB_DEPENDS=	libSvtAv1Enc.so:multimedia/svt-av1
-SVT_CMAKE_BOOL=		WITH_SvtEnc
-SVT_BROKEN=		breaks some dependent ports
+SVTAV1_LIB_DEPENDS=	libSvtAv1Enc.so:multimedia/svt-av1
+SVTAV1_CMAKE_BOOL=	WITH_SvtEnc
+SVTAV1_BROKEN=		breaks some dependent ports
 
 RAV1E_LIB_DEPENDS=	librav1e.so:multimedia/librav1e
 RAV1E_CMAKE_BOOL=	WITH_RAV1E
diff --git a/graphics/libheif/pkg-plist b/graphics/libheif/pkg-plist
index a397c9f6cc28..2bd514d0046e 100644
--- a/graphics/libheif/pkg-plist
+++ b/graphics/libheif/pkg-plist
@@ -13,7 +13,7 @@ lib/gdk-pixbuf-2.0/%%GTK2_VERSION%%/loaders/libpixbufloader-heif.so
 lib/libheif.so
 lib/libheif.so.1
 lib/libheif.so.%%LIB_VER%%
-%%SVT%%lib/libheif/libheif-svtenc.so
+%%SVTAV1%%lib/libheif/libheif-svtenc.so
 %%RAV1E%%lib/libheif/libheif-rav1e.so
 libdata/pkgconfig/libheif.pc
 %%PORTEXAMPLES%%share/man/man1/heif-convert.1.gz



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?202212020133.2B21X1rC029956>